Yes, Georgia does tax partnerships, but the tax structure differs from corporations. Partnerships are generally pass-through entities, meaning the income is reported on the individual partners' tax returns rather than taxed at the partnership level. Properly structuring your Georgia Simple Partnership Agreement helps ensure all partners understand their tax obligations and responsibilities.

No, a partnership does not have to be split evenly at 50/50. The ownership structure can vary based on the contributions and agreements made by the partners. In your Georgia Simple Partnership Agreement, you can define how profits and losses are shared, allowing for flexibility in ownership percentages that reflect each partner's input.

A Georgia Simple Partnership Agreement typically contains the partnership name, purpose, and terms of operation. Additionally, it outlines the financial contributions of each partner and specifies how profits and losses will be divided. Including procedures for adding or removing partners can protect the partnership's longevity.
